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of U-shaped beam formwork technology, specifically to a U-shaped beam formwork with high toughness and high rigidity. Background Technology

[0002] U-shaped beam formwork is a construction mold specifically designed for precast U-shaped beams. It consists of a bottom mold, inner and outer molds, and end molds, and its opening and closing are controlled by a hydraulic or mechanical system. Its unique asymmetrical U-shaped structure effectively reduces bridge construction height and improves space utilization, making it suitable for scenarios such as elevated rail transit bridges. The formwork system is characterized by convenient movement, efficient installation and dismantling, and precise forming. Combined with high-performance concrete and advanced vibration compaction technology, it ensures the quality of the beam. With increasing infrastructure investment and technological innovation, the market demand for U-shaped beam formwork continues to grow, with environmental friendliness and lightweight design becoming the development trends.

[0003] Chinese patent CN221496515U discloses a U-shaped beam formwork, including a support and a formwork. The formwork includes an outer mold and an inner mold. The outer mold is fixed on the support, and the inner mold is located on the side of the outer mold away from the support. The inner mold is U-shaped and has a counterweight. The counterweight and the support are detachably connected by a first tie rod. By using the first tie rod, the inner mold can be quickly replaced according to different pouring requirements without having to disassemble other parts multiple times, simplifying the entire replacement process. This makes the connection and disassembly of the formwork with the support more convenient and efficient, reducing manual labor intensity and improving construction efficiency.

[0004] The U-shaped beam formwork described in the aforementioned patent document allows for quick replacement of the inner mold according to different pouring requirements, solving the problem of repeated disassembly and replacement of the inner mold and reducing manual labor intensity. However, the inner membrane of the aforementioned U-shaped beam formwork has a large volume, making it impossible to fold and store it. [0027] To further understand the features, technical means, and specific objectives and functions achieved by this utility model, the following detailed description of this utility model is provided in conjunction with the accompanying drawings and specific embodiments.

[0028] See Figures 1-6 As shown, a U-shaped beam formwork with high toughness and high rigidity includes two sets of outer formwork 1, a floating frame 6 set on top of the two sets of outer formwork 1, and an inner formwork 5 set on the bottom of the floating frame 6, including a side plate 51. The top of the side plate 51 is hinged to the lower end face of the floating frame 6, and a folding plate 52 is hinged to the bottom of the side plate 51.

[0029] A boss 60 is provided at the center of the lower end face of the floating frame 6. Several first hydraulic telescopic members 7 are provided at equal intervals on both sides of the boss 60. One end of the first hydraulic telescopic member 7 is hinged to the boss 60, and the output end of the first hydraulic telescopic member 7 is hinged to one side of the side plate 51.

[0030] A second hydraulic telescopic member 8 is hinged to one side of the side plate 51, and the output end of the second hydraulic telescopic member 8 is hinged to one side of the folding plate 52.

[0031] When folding the inner formwork 5, firstly, the second hydraulic telescopic component 8 is activated, causing its output end to retract. This moves the folding plate 52, gradually bringing one side of the folding plate 52 closer to the side plate 51. The folding plate 52 and side plate 51 then gradually become parallel, allowing the folding plate 52 to fold up. Then, the first hydraulic telescopic component 7 is activated, causing its output end to retract. This moves the side plate 51, gradually aligning it with the lower surface of the floating frame 6. This allows the inner formwork 5 to fold, solving the problem of the large size and inconvenient storage of the U-shaped beam formwork.

[0032] See Figure 1 , Figure 4 and Figure 5 As shown, several positioning rods 11 are fixed at equal intervals on the top of the two sets of outer templates 1;

[0033] The floating frame 6 has a positioning hole 63 near its edge that can penetrate its upper and lower surfaces. The positioning hole 63 is adapted to the positioning rod 11.

[0034] To ensure the stability of the floating frame 6, a positioning hole 63 is opened at the edge of the floating frame 6, so that the positioning rod 11 at the top of the outer template 1 can be inserted into the positioning hole 63. This allows the positioning rod 11 and the positioning hole 63 to cooperate with each other, effectively preventing the floating frame 6 from shifting.

[0035] See Figure 1 , Figure 3 , Figure 4 and Figure 6 As shown, a support assembly 2 for supporting the outer template 1 is provided on the outer side surface. The support assembly 2 includes a sleeve 22. A threaded rod 21 that can move along its central axis is installed on the top of the sleeve 22. One end of the threaded rod 21 is hinged to the outer side surface of the outer template 1.

[0036] By installing the threaded rod 21 inside the sleeve 22, the threaded rod 21 can move along the central axis of the sleeve 22, thereby allowing the overall length of the support assembly 2 to be adjusted. By hinged one end of the threaded rod 21 to the outer side of the outer template 1, the threaded rod 21 and the sleeve 22 cooperate to support the outer template 1, thereby improving the load-bearing strength of the outer template 1.

[0037] See Figure 6 As shown, a rotating component 23 capable of rotating around its central axis is installed on the top of the sleeve 22. The rotating component 23 is fitted outside the threaded rod 21 and is threadedly connected to the threaded rod 21.

[0038] When the rotating component 23 is rotated, the rotating component 23 can drive the threaded rod 21 connected to it to move along the central axis of the sleeve 22, so that the overall length of the support component 2 can be adjusted, thereby making the support component 2 adaptable to a wider range.

[0039] See Figure 2 and Figure 4 As shown, the bottom of the two sets of outer templates 1 are hinged to a base plate 3 that can be flipped.

[0040] A filling plate 4 is provided between the two sets of outer templates 1, and the two sides of the filling plate 4 are fixedly connected to the base plate 3 respectively.

[0041] By fixing the two sides of the filling plate 4 to the base plate 3 respectively, the outer template 1, the base plate 3 and the filling plate 4 are matched with each other to shape the U-shaped beam, effectively ensuring the shape of the U-shaped beam.

[0042] See Figure 1 , Figure 3 and Figure 4 As shown, the upper end face of the floating frame 6 is symmetrically fixed with a lifting lug 61 that is connected to the hook.

[0043] To facilitate the hoisting of the floating frame 6, multiple lifting lugs 61 are symmetrically installed on the upper surface of the floating frame 6. This allows the hook to be hooked onto the lifting lugs 61, thus facilitating the hoisting operation of the floating frame 6.

[0044] See Figure 1 , Figure 3 , Figure 4 and Figure 5 As shown, the floating frame 6 has filling ports 62 for filling aggregate on both sides near the positioning holes 63.

[0045] To facilitate the filling of aggregate into the U-shaped beam formwork, filling ports 62 are opened on both sides of the floating frame 6, allowing the aggregate to be filled into the U-shaped beam formwork through the filling ports 62.

[0046] See Figure 4As shown, a storage groove 12 for storing the base plate 3 is provided at the bottom of the outer side wall of the outer template 1.

[0047] By opening a storage groove 12 on the outer side wall at the bottom of the outer template 1, the base plate 3 can be placed inside the storage groove 12 when folded, making the storage of the base plate 3 more convenient.
